Quasar插件是您可以在Vue文件中以及在其外部使用的功能,如Notify、BottomSheet、AppVisibility等。 WARNING 在你的应用程序中使用它们之前,你需要在/quasar.config.js中添加对它们的引用(如下所示)。 framework:{plugins:['Notify','BottomSheet']} 我们以Notify为例,看看如何使用它。 在Vue文件中,您将编写如下内容 ...
打开终端,运行以下命令以全局安装Quasar CLI: bash npm install -g @quasar/cli 创建新的Quasar项目(如果您想从头开始一个新项目): 在终端中运行以下命令来创建一个新的Quasar项目: bash quasar create my-quasar-project 按照提示选择项目配置,如是否使用TypeScript、选择CSS预处理器等。 创建完成后,进入项目...
通过NPM安装Quasar CLI是安装Quasar的基础步骤,确保您有全局访问权限,并能使用Quasar提供的所有命令和工具。 打开终端:可以使用系统自带的终端应用程序。 运行安装命令:在终端输入以下命令并回车: npm install -g @quasar/cli 二、初始化Quasar项目 在安装Quasar CLI之后,您可以创建一个新的Quasar项目。以下是具体的步...
// quasar.conf.js -> build -> vueRouterMode // quasar.conf.js -> build -> publicPath mode: process.env.VUE_ROUTER_MODE, base: process.env.VUE_ROUTER_BASE }); const whiteList = ["/login", "/403"]; function hasPermission(router) { if (whiteList.indexOf(router.path) !== -1) {...
基于Vue和Quasar的前端SPA项目实战之环境搭建(一) 背景 crudapi增删改查接口系统的后台Java API服务已经全部可用,需要一套后台管理UI,主要用户为开发人员或者对计算机有一定了解的工作人员,通过UI配置元数据和处理业务数据,经过调研最终决定通过Vue实现SPA单页面Web应用,打开浏览器就可以很方便使用。
通过上一篇文章基于Vue和Quasar的前端SPA项目实战之环境搭建(一)的介绍,我们已经搭建好本地开发环境并且运行成功了,今天主要介绍登录功能。 简介 通常为了安全考虑,需要用户登录之后才可以访问。crudapi admin web项目也需要引入登录功能,用户登录成功之后,跳转到管理页面,否则提示没有权限。
Quasar用$q对象注入Vue原型:注入类型说明 $q.version 字符串 quasar版本。 $q.theme 字符串 正在使用的主题。 例如:mat,ios $q.platform 对象 从Quasar导入与平台相同的对象。 $q.i18n 对象 Quasar国际化,包含标签等(i18n文件之一)。 专为Quasar组件设计,但您也可以在您的应用组件中使用。 $q.cordova 对象 引用...
Vue Quasar 是一个基于 Vue.js 的框架,它提供了一系列的 UI 组件,用于快速开发响应式的前端应用。QSelect 是其中的一个组件,用于创建下拉选择框。当涉及到异步数据时,可能会遇到默认显示 [对象对象] 的情况,这是因为 QSelect 默认使用对象的字符串表示作为选项的显示文本。 基础概念 QSelect: Vue Quasar...
报错了,找不到quasar命令,所以从新机器运行已有项目也不要忘记安装quasar环境: pnpm add -g @quasar/cli 新电脑运行vue需要重新搭建环境,之前文章有写过当然也可以用,只是时间有些久,我就去官网看看装个最新版node吧。 https://nodejs.org/zh-cn
通过上一篇文章 基于Vue和Quasar的前端SPA项目实战之序列号(四)的介绍,我们已经完成了元数据中序列号的增删改查,本文主要介绍动态表单设计功能的实现。 简介 在crudapi系统中,所有的业务表单都是通过配置动态生成的,代码无需写死,有关基本概念参考之前文章元数据管理—动态表单设计器在crudapi系统中完整实现 ,表单配置...